Director, Contract Policy
Ms. Miller serves as the Director for Contract Policy in the Office of the Principal Director, Defense Pricing, Contracting, and Acquisition Policy (DPCAP), within the Office of the Under Secretary of Defense for Acquisition and Sustainment. In this capacity, she oversees the development of new, innovative acquisition guidance and policies, and ensures the currency of existing policy to support a responsive acquisition system in support of warfighter mission needs. In addition, she supports major acquisition program reviews and the policy, guidance and authorities that underpin the contingency contracting mission in response to humanitarian, disaster, and contingency operations.
Ms. Miller previously served as the Director of Procurement Policy in the Office of the Deputy Assistant Secretary of the Army (Procurement) (ODASA(P)) within the Assistant Secretary of the Army for Acquisition, Logistics, and Technology (ASA(ALT)). She was responsible for evaluation, advocacy, development, maintenance, and communication of innovative procurement related policies and procedures that promote accountability, integrity, and efficiency throughout the contracting enterprise.
Ms. Miller’s prior positions within ODASA(P) included Team Lead for the Procurement Support Directorate and procurement analyst in the Services and Category Management Directorate. Prior to joining ASA(ALT), Ms. Miller served as a procurement analyst in the acquisition policy directorate at the National Guard Bureau; Branch Chief for Army Contracting Command, Detroit Arsenal (ACC-DTA) supporting the Army Intelligence and Security Command (INSCOM); Contracting Officer for the INSCOM acquisition center; and a contract specialist for Marine Corps Systems Command (MCSC). While at MCSC, Ms. Miller was selected for detail assignments with the Defense Contracting and Pricing (DPC) acquisition exchange program and the Navy Director for Acquisition Career Management (DACM) office.
Ms. Miller holds a Master of Laws (LLM) in Government Procurement from George Washington University Law school; a Juris Doctor (JD) from University of Georgia School of Law; a Masters in Teaching, Bachelor of Arts in English, and Bachelor of Science in Psychology from Virginia Commonwealth University. Ms. Miller is DAWIA Level III certified in Contracting, DAWIA Level I certified in Program Management, a member of the Army Acquisition Corps, and recipient of multiple awards, including the Army Superior Civilian Service Award in 2017 and the Army Commander’s Award for Civilian Service 2017 and 2020. She is a member of the National Contract Management Association (NCMA).
